Myth: Dental Surgery Is Constantly Uncomfortable



You might assume that dental surgery constantly entails discomfort, but that's just not true. As opposed to common belief, dental surgery treatments aren't always excruciating experiences. Thanks to advancements in anesthetic and sedation strategies, oral surgeons have the ability to guarantee that individuals fit and pain-free during the entire treatment.

Before the surgery starts, you'll be provided anesthetic, which numbs the location being dealt with and avoids you from feeling any kind of pain. In addition, if you experience any anxiety or anxiety, your oral surgeon can carry out sedation to aid you unwind and feel more at ease.

Whether you're getting a tooth removal, oral implant, or jaw surgery, rest assured that oral surgery can be a pain-free and comfortable experience.

Myth: Oral Surgery Is Only for Emergency situations



Unlike common belief, oral surgery isn't restricted to emergency situations.

While it's true that oral surgery can be necessary in cases of severe trauma or sudden pain, it's also commonly used for intended procedures that enhance the overall health and wellness and function of your mouth.

As an example, if you have misaligned jaws or teeth that do not fit properly, oral surgery can fix these problems and protect against future issues.

In addition, oral surgery can be carried out to get rid of affected wisdom teeth, treat periodontal condition, or location dental implants.

By resolving these issues before they become emergencies, oral surgery can assist keep your oral health and wellness and protect against even more serious problems down the line.

Myth: Dental Surgery Is Risky and Dangerous



Many individuals erroneously think that dental surgery poses a significant risk and danger to their health. However, this is a common misconception that requires to be exposed.

While any surgery comes with some level of threat, dental surgery is normally safe and carried out by extremely educated experts. Dental professionals and dental specialists undergo years of education and training to make sure the highest degree of proficiency in performing these treatments.



In addition, innovations in modern technology and anesthesia have actually substantially improved the security of oral surgery. As a matter of fact, the dangers associated with oral surgery are often outweighed by the advantages it offers, such as alleviating discomfort, enhancing oral wellness, and improving total wellness.

It's important to speak with a certified oral doctor to deal with any type of issues and make an informed decision about your dental wellness requirements.

Myth: Oral Surgery Is Not Necessary for Good Oral Health



Oral surgery plays an important function in maintaining great dental health. In contrast to the prominent misconception, it isn't just a cosmetic procedure or an unnecessary luxury. clearchoice com 's why dental surgery is necessary for your oral health and wellness:

- Extraction of influenced knowledge teeth: Eliminating affected knowledge teeth protects against congestion, infection, and prospective damages to surrounding teeth.

- Treatment of dental infections: Dental surgery can assist treat severe gum tissue infections, abscesses, and various other oral infections that can cause significant health complications if left unattended.

- Rehabilitative jaw surgical procedure: Jaw misalignment can create difficulty in eating, speech problems, and can even result in temporomandibular joint (TMJ) disorder. Dental surgery can deal with these issues.

- Dental implants: Oral surgery is required for placing dental implants, which are the best remedy for replacing missing out on teeth.

- Therapy of dental cancer cells: Oral surgery is commonly needed for the elimination of cancerous growths and the restoration of cells impacted by oral cancer cells.

Do not succumb to the misconception that oral surgery is unnecessary. It's an important part of maintaining excellent oral wellness and stopping more problems.
